
Hello, PebbleGo Health was launched this week and MeL users will have access to it until August 31. This new module introduces K-3 kids to fundamental health, safety, and social-emotional concepts. Many of MeL's eResources vendors have provided temporary resources designed to assist Michigan Residents during COVID-19. PebbleGo Health from Capstone is the most recent. You can find all of these resources on the Learning from home during COVID-19<https://mel.org/covid19> page at MeL.org. The PebbleGo modules that MeL currently offers are Animals and Social Studies. Since the COVID-19 outbreak, Capstone has also provided MeL with the modules - Science, Biographies, Dinosaurs, and now, Health. These additional modules are available until August 31.
